Transaction 95e076473376c9ac8c4af319c40335aab52e0cb034f2fcf62d15be796d89fbc9
1 Input
1 Output
-
95e076473376c9ac8c4af319c40335aab52e0cb034f2fcf62d15be796d89fbc9:0
- value
- 99986439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b028c00effa0778b99cf8878158613499622a02 OP_EQUAL
- address
- 3752qpft9a1BWRTu8sFExYTAsNYEAHKmDE